  • Marijuana is the most commonly used illicit drug in the U.S., with over 17 million past-month users.
  • Marijuana use has been found to worsen cases of psychosis patients with schizophrenia.
  • According to an article in the magazine "European Addiction Research", about 60% of people do not complete their inpatient programs for addiction.

Outpatient

Outpatient services are on the lower end of the spectrum of treatment solutions with regards to intensity of care, as the individual can maintain their lifestyle in lots of ways with no commitment of needing to remain in a rehabilitation center while undergoing rehabilitation services. Even though this might seem perfect it may not provide the required change of atmosphere than many people in rehab require to experience a successful rehabilitation.

Persons With Co-Occurring Mental And Substance Abuse Disorders

Persons with co-occurring mental and drug use problems are what are recognized in the field of drug rehab as dual diagnosis clients. These clients must handle both disorders while in treatment to find resolution simply because one typically triggers the other. Fortunately, there are many alcohol and drug rehabilitation centers who can specifically hone in on the problems that persons with co-occurring mental and drug abuse issues face so that they can not merely become abstinent but mentally stable and also able to lead a much higher quality lifestyle and never feel the need to self medicate with drugs and alcohol.

ASL or Other Assistance for Hearing Impaired

The hearing impaired can often be predisposed to alcoholism and substance abuse due to problems that their impairment impose on them. While detection of this problem is often difficult among the hearing impaired, you can find ASL and also other assistance services intended for them when substance abuse treatment is needed. Apart from ASL, such services can include assistive listening tools and captioned video materials to ensure that deaf and hearing impaired folks are receiving the support they need in alcohol and drug rehabilitation.

Self Payment

Self Payment is necessary when someone's insurance isn't going to pay for the total cost of treatment or will only pay for some of it. In these instances, it may seem like a drawback but people actually have a great deal of leverage simply because they can decide on whichever facility they would like without the restrictions from health insurance providers that so many individuals encounter. In addition, rehabilitation facilities will often provide payment assistance for individuals whose only option is self payment to help them get into treatment.

Private Health Insurance

Depending on which plan you are covered by, all private medical insurance plans typically cover some type of drug and alcohol treatment service including outpatient rehabilitation to inpatient or residential alcohol and drug rehab centers. Individuals could possibly have to participate in a drug and alcohol rehab center which is in their network of providers and there can be other restrictions including the length of time their stay in rehab is covered. Individuals can choose an excellent facility they like and speak with a rehabilitation specialist to find out if their insurance will take care of it.
